New Results for the Complexity of Resilience for Binary Conjunctive Queries with Self-Joins
Summary: Dichotomy for resilience of single-self-join binary conjunctive queries with exactly two repeated relations; shows triads insufficient and identifies new structural obstructions—chains, confluences, permutations—that yield NP-hard cases. Also gives novel reductions to network flow proving many remaining patterns are in P and relates the results to deletion-propagation with source-side effects.
